      mlxsw: spectrum_flower: Make vlan_id limitation more specific · 70ec72d5
      Amit Cohen authored
      Spectrum ASICs do not support matching of VLAN ID at egress.
      Currently, mlxsw driver forbids matching of all VLAN related fields at
      egress, which is too strict check.
      
      For example, the following filter is not supported by the driver:
      $ tc filter add dev swpX egress protocol 802.1q pref 1 handle 101 flower
      vlan_ethtype ipv4 src_ip .. dst_ip .. skip_sw action pass
      Error: mlxsw_spectrum: vlan_id key is not supported on egress.
      We have an error talking to the kernel
      
      The filter above does not match on VLAN ID, but is bounced anyway.
      
      Make the check more specific, forbid only matching of 'vlan_id' at egress.

      Merge tag 'mlx5-updates-2021-12-21'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/saeed/linux · 5de24da1
      Jakub Kicinski authored
      Saeed Mahameed says:
      
      ====================
      mlx5-updates-2021-12-21
      
      1) From Shay Drory: Devlink user knobs to control device's EQ size
      
      This series provides knobs which will enable users to
      minimize memory consumption of mlx5 Functions (PF/VF/SF).
      mlx5 exposes two new generic devlink params for EQ size
      configuration and uses devlink generic param max_macs.
      
      LINK: https://lore.kernel.org/netdev/20211208141722.13646-1-shayd@nvidia.com/
      
      2) From Tariq and Lama, allocate software channel objects and statistics
        of a mlx5 netdevice private data dynamically upon first demand to save on
        memory.
